About the Hotel

6452 West Us Highway 61, Tofte, Minnesota, United States of America, 55615

Cliff Dweller on Lake Superior is located on the scenic North Shore of Minnesota. This hotel features sweeping views of Lake Superior from all guest rooms, each complete with private balconies. The hotel serves as a base for outdoor enthusiasts, with activities ranging from hiking to skiing nearby. Its proximity to attractions like Lutsen Mountains further adds to its appeal for travelers seeking adventure or relaxation.

Location

Situated just north of Tofte, Cliff Dweller is a short drive from Lutsen Mountains and other popular attractions. Nearby state parks, such as Cascade River State Park, offer picturesque waterfalls and scenic hiking trails. The hotel is located approximately 90 miles from Duluth International Airport, making it accessible for travelers. Free parking is provided for guests with vehicles.

Rooms

All 22 guest rooms are comfortably decorated and offer sliding glass doors that lead to individual balconies. Rooms come equipped with either two double beds or a single king bed, along with modern amenities such as mini-fridges and microwaves. Each room provides stunning views of Lake Superior and features eco-friendly bath amenities. Accessible options with additional features for those with limited mobility are also available.

Eat & Drink

Cliff Dweller offers a complimentary continental breakfast that includes a selection of muffins, pastries, and beverages in a sunroom overlooking the lake. Guests can enjoy a 10% discount at the nearby Cascade Restaurant & Pub for lunch and dinner. For additional dining options, local establishments featuring fresh seafood and international cuisine are easily accessible within a short drive.

Leisure & Business

Outdoor activities abound in the area, including hiking, fishing, and biking on the Gitchi-Gami State Trail directly accessible from the hotel. In winter, nearby Lutsen Mountains offers opportunities for downhill skiing and snowmobiling. The hotel provides complimentary use of trail cruiser bikes for guests wishing to explore the scenic surroundings. Additionally, various local festivals and events take place throughout the year, providing a lively atmosphere.
